Lin Fan is one of the founders of the Society of Chinese Gongbi Style Painting.
An exhibition through July 26 at the National Art Museum of China in Beijing pays tribute to his accomplishments in promoting the long-standing gongbi-style of classic Chinese painting.
On show are more than 120 pieces from his outputs of gongbi paintings and calligraphy. In his work, Lin presents a comparison between the real and the abstract, as well as a sense of rhythm and forces.
